Beautiful 35 acres in the heart of New Hope/Solebury, surrounded by 200 acres of conserved farmland that will never be developed-- this property offers complete privacy and is set back on one of the most tranquil, sought-after roads in the area. The home is located just minutes from the towns of Lambertville and New Hope with the Delaware River running between them. Enjoy the tranquility of this property with its nature trails and the Pidcock Creek, complete with a waterfall, running through the backyard. There is a wide variety of wildlife including a rookery of great herons nearby, one of a very few rookeries in the whole state. Bring your horses, as the property boasts excellent horse facilities that are suitable for either the amateur or professional. The long tree-lined driveway leads you to the home discreetly tucked away from views from the road. Enter through the front door and you will be greeted by a view of the lush gardens, creek and waterfall. Windows across the entire length of the house offer that same view.
The two-story great room is flanked by a breath-taking wall of exposed stone and a large stone fireplace. A cozy reading/sitting room is adjacent to the great room. The large dining room is enclosed on three sides by windows looking out on the back yard and creek. The gourmet kitchen is expansive and would please the most advanced chef. It features beautiful soapstone countertops, high-end appliances, beautiful custom wooden cabinets and a large breakfast room. The laundry room area is conveniently located next to the kitchen. A spacious family/media room with a small office nook and sliding glass doors leads out to one of the patios. There is a large bedroom suite on the main floor with a full bath, walk-in closet, sliding glass door to your private patio, and an office/sitting/reading room. The second story solo suite is located at the other end of the home and has access without having to go through the house - a good spot for live-in help or a nanny. There are also three additional spacious bedrooms on the second floor. A lovely pool and hot tub are steps away from the bedroom suite. There is a large three-car garage with 1200 square feet of finished space above, a spectacular room with views of the pond and pastures. A raised bed vegetable garden with a pergola is just outside. The horse facilities accommodate either the amateur or professional. There is a seven stall barn with excellent ventilation, a wide concrete aisle, a large loft for hay storage, a heated and air conditioned tack room and feed room, and a wash stall with heat lamps and hot/cold water. Every stall opens to a gravel paddock; there are three fenced pastures with another 6-8 acres that could be fenced in. The outdoor ring is 100 x 200 and has excellent footing; lights from the barn provide light at night. There are trails that can be ridden throughout the property.
